Thought I'd give a quick sneak peek at the next book due out from Apodis. This, as you can see, is Stumble Down the Mountainside from Ian Donnell Arbuckle. If you got your hands on a copy of Goodbye, Darwin, you might remember Ian's kickass story "Hard Wonder".The cover blurb for the novel goes a little something like this: Lithium has just graduated college and wants nothing more than to sleep in late on summer mornings and occasionally hit his younger brother with a stick. One morning, he wakes up to find the rest of humanity gone, destroyed in a man-made apocalypse -- but somehow his family is untouched. Drug-addled Mom; his brothers, suicidal Brat and jelly-spined paranoiac Grant; his Dad the zombie. Lithium begins to feel like the center of a brand new rarity: the dysfunctional family. He is the tormented middle child, but he's the last middle child on Earth. As far as he is concerned, that means he gets the write the rules from here on out. I'm hoping for a release date within the next couple of months, but I'll be sure to let you all know.
